International Journal of Critical Infrastructures is an academic journal published by INDERSCIENCE ENTERPRISES LTD (United Kingdom). Identifiers: ISSN 1475-3219, eISSN 1741-8038. Indexed in SCIE, SCOPUS. Metrics: JIF 0.5, CiteScore 1.1, SJR 0.146, SNIP 0.26. Subject areas: ENGINEERING, MULTIDISCIPLINARY. tlooto lists 167 papers from this journal.
